add date field; v3 route

master
DIYgod 6 years ago
parent b3c5ed21ec
commit e71a23907d
No known key found for this signature in database
GPG Key ID: EC0B76A252D3EF67
  1. 4
      router.js
  2. 3
      routes/post.js
  3. 1
      utils/mongodb.js

@ -1,7 +1,7 @@
const Router = require('koa-router');
const router = new Router();
router.get('/', require('./routes/get'));
router.post('/', require('./routes/post'));
router.get('/v3', require('./routes/get'));
router.post('/v3', require('./routes/post'));
module.exports = router;

@ -11,7 +11,8 @@ module.exports = async (ctx) => {
color: body.color,
type: body.type,
ip: ctx.ips[0] || ctx.ip,
referer: ctx.headers.referer
referer: ctx.headers.referer,
date: +new Date(),
});
dan.save((err, data) => {
if (err) {

@ -24,6 +24,7 @@ const danmakuSchema = new mongoose.Schema({
type: Number,
ip: String,
referer: String,
date: Number,
});
const danmaku = mongoose.model('dan', danmakuSchema);

Loading…
Cancel
Save